]> git.ipfire.org Git - thirdparty/vim.git/commit
patch 9.1.0500: cannot switch buffer in a popup v9.1.0500
authorChristian Brabandt <cb@256bit.org>
Tue, 18 Jun 2024 18:50:58 +0000 (20:50 +0200)
committerChristian Brabandt <cb@256bit.org>
Tue, 18 Jun 2024 19:01:23 +0000 (21:01 +0200)
commitfbc37f138a5d70f1b212b9de9959a0816481edcf
tree17f8ace4a09dd5054c82e6f38491d3e2e0a7f0ca
parent23c5ebeb95cb942df307946e3ced230a7c8312eb
patch 9.1.0500: cannot switch buffer in a popup

Problem:  cannot switch buffer in a popup
          (Yggdroot)
Solution: add popup_setbuf() function

fixes: #15006
closes: #15026

Signed-off-by: Christian Brabandt <cb@256bit.org>
17 files changed:
runtime/doc/builtin.txt
runtime/doc/popup.txt
runtime/doc/tags
runtime/doc/usr_41.txt
runtime/doc/version9.txt
src/evalfunc.c
src/popupwin.c
src/proto/popupwin.pro
src/testdir/dumps/Test_popup_setbuf_01.dump [new file with mode: 0644]
src/testdir/dumps/Test_popup_setbuf_02.dump [new file with mode: 0644]
src/testdir/dumps/Test_popup_setbuf_03.dump [new file with mode: 0644]
src/testdir/dumps/Test_popup_setbuf_04.dump [new file with mode: 0644]
src/testdir/dumps/Test_popup_setbuf_05.dump [new file with mode: 0644]
src/testdir/dumps/Test_popup_setbuf_06.dump [new file with mode: 0644]
src/testdir/test_popupwin.vim
src/testdir/test_vim9_builtin.vim
src/version.c